Russia plans to increase potato imports

Since 2024, Russia has experienced a significant increase in edible potato imports, with a 60.8% rise from Belarus, a more than three-fold increase from China, and a over seven-fold increase from Armenia. The total import volume reaches 395.5 thousand tons. Russia aims to further increase potato imports by boosting supplies from Belarus, Egypt, Azerbaijan, China, and Pakistan.

since the beginning of 2024, Russia has imported 395.5 thousand tons of edible potatoes. This is reported by FreshPlaza. Since the beginning of 2024, there has been a significant increase in the import of potatoes to Russia from some countries, reports the Rossilkhoznadzor.
